Data: Global Passport Power Rank 2025

NEW data has shown that Zimbabwe’s passport grants its holders visa-free access to 63 destinations, placing it at position 80 in the 2025 Henley Passport Index. The ranking highlights sharp disparities in travel freedom across Southern Africa, where island nations continue to outperform mainland countries. Mutoko mine killing sparks outrage amid rising anger over Chinese abuses

POLICE are investigating the circumstances under which a Chinese national allegedly shot dead a Zimbabwean worker at a gold mine in Mutoko early Thursday, an incident that has reignited tensions over abuses by Chinese miners across the country.
